Eight Czech Insurers Adopt AI Flood Risk Platform as Europe Confronts Underinsurance Crisis

Eight major insurers representing a majority of the Czech residential property insurance market have deployed Intermap Technologies' AI-powered flood risk platform for underwriting, property valuation and portfolio management. The multi-year rollout, announced April 1, establishes a unified flood risk framework across the Czech insurance sector and incorporates updated hydrological data following the September 2024 floods.

The deployment was developed with the Czech Insurance Association and the Czech Hydrometeorological Institute. It includes sixth-generation river flood maps and second-generation flash flood models calibrated to account for the 2024 flooding events.

Closing Europe's Protection Gap

The Czech adoption reflects a broader crisis: 25-40% of natural catastrophe losses in Europe go uninsured, according to Swiss Re sigma research. In some markets, properties are insured for as little as 40% of replacement value due to rapid price appreciation and outdated valuation methods.

Insurers lack the data infrastructure to accurately price risk or value properties. The Czech deployment addresses this by embedding geospatial intelligence directly into underwriting workflows.

Technical Capabilities

Intermap's 2026 flood models include revised return-period classifications across impacted basins and integration of bridge capacity and bottleneck effects across more than 130 municipalities. The system uses 20-centimeter digital elevation simulations to model urban flash flooding at building-level precision.

The Risk Assistant platform automates property-level risk evaluation at scale. Rather than static address lookups, the system integrates 3D elevation data, vector datasets and multi-peril hazard layers-including hail, wind, lightning and seismic activity-to deliver property-specific risk assessments in real time.

Market Implications

Jan MatouΕ‘ek, Executive Director of the Czech Insurance Association, said the platform "enables precise, object-level evaluation and supports more informed underwriting and reinsurance decisions across the market."

Patrick A. Blott, Chairman and CEO of Intermap, said the Czech deployment demonstrates that "advanced geospatial analytics are becoming core underwriting infrastructure across Europe, not supplemental tools." He added that combining proprietary 3D data with AI automation delivers "investment-grade geospatial intelligence with assured position, accuracy and timing."

The platform supports more accurate property valuation, exposure transparency and risk-based pricing-critical for addressing systemic underinsurance across European markets.
